Lady loses job opportunity for wearing leg chain and many earrings to interview

  • A Nigerian man has blown hot on social media after his female friend missed out on a job opportunity because of her appearance
  • The lady applied for the role of personal assistant to the CEO of an oil servicing firm and had aced the first interview
  • However, she was not interviewed for the second round for wearing leg chain and having multiple ear piercings

A female job seeker has lost a job opportunity for having multiple ear piercings and wearing a leg chain to the interview.

The lady’s friend, @Chrisllionaire_, expressed his displeasure over the development on X.

@Chrisllionaire_ said his friend applied for the position of a personal assistant to the CEO of an oil servicing firm and was set for the second round of interview after passing the first one.

The CEO did not like her appearance and communicated it to @Chrisllionaire_. The Nigerian man was not pleased with how the CEO ‘thrashed’ his female friend over how she dressed.

He released a WhatsApp chat where his female friend lamented how the CEO treated her.

“I’ve been fuming for the past 12 hours. Someone applied for a personal assistant job to the CEO of an oil servicing firm. She aced the first interview and was set for the second round with the CEO and another person.

“But the guy totally tra§hed her appearance just because she had multiple ear piercings, wore a leg chain, and had visible pan.ty lines. Seriously, what happened to being decent about stuff you don’t like? If you’ve got reservations, keep them to yourself. I’m boiling over this,” @Chrisllionaire_ wrote on X.
